Inside Gymnast Olivia Dunne and MLB Star Paul Skenes’ Winning Romance

Olivia “Livvy” Dunne and Paul Skenes—who met while they were both athletes at LSU—have taken the world by storm as the new sports “it couple.”
The Pittsburg Pirates pitcher, who signed on with the team in July 2023, met the gymnast through his college roommate and best friend—who was dating her roommate at the time. It wasn’t until Livvy posted a TikTok video wearing Paul’s jersey, in June 2023, that fans started speculating a budding romance.
Two months after the video was posted, Paul confirmed their relationship. But he also admitted that their position in the public eye came with a few challenges.
"I do wish she could come to a baseball game and just enjoy it. It does irk me," the 22-year-old told the Pittsburgh Post-Gazette. "I don't have any control over it. She really doesn't either. I'm sure it'll get better as I go up levels, but that's something I want for her."
But the extra attention doesn’t stop the social media sensation from cheering on her boyfriend from the stands. In fact, Livvy finds herself getting extra invested when he’s on the field.
“I get more nervous watching Paul because it’s just different when you’re not doing it and you’re not in control,” she told the New York Post in June. “But I am confident in his abilities and I kinda channel those nerves into excitement for him.”
And since he knows the pressure and thrill of athletic competition all too well, her boyfriend was the first person Livvy called after winning her first NCAA Gymnastics Championship title in April.
"I just wanted to fill him in on what just happened because I know he just won a national championship at LSU," she told People. "He understands all the feelings so I just wanted to call him and just tell him what it was like."
In fact, these two are often each other’s biggest fans. All eyes were on this dazzling couple as they walked hand in hand at the MLB All-Star Game red carpet in June. And during their first red carpet appearance together, Livvy could not help but express her admiration for Paul ahead of his All-Star game debut.
“My brain can’t even process how hard he throws,” she said on the red carpet, per a video posted on X by the MLB. “It is incredible and it’s such a joy to watch. He’s a great baseball player, but an even better person.”
